„The payment card creates a modern and practical solution that will reduce administrative effort in the long term and make the abuse of social benefits more difficult. At the same time, by paying out part of the benefits in cash, the dignity and autonomy of those affected are preserved,“ emphasizes the chairman of FDP-Saar, Oliver Luksic, MdB.
The FDP Saar points out that the introduction of the payment card is by no means discriminatory; rather, it helps to promote social cohesion by reducing misunderstandings about the use of funds. The focus is on a fair and responsible design of social benefits. After the FDP was able to push through the fundamental introduction of the payment card in Berlin despite much resistance, the FDP Saar expects the Saarland Ministry of the Interior to now promptly implement the introduction of the payment card in Saarland. It should also be used as comprehensively as possible and not only for newcomers.
